Types of Garage Door Rollers
There are three main types of door rollers. Many manufacturers and brands sell these rollers for all garage owners. Choose the rollers that fit your needs best.
Nylon Rollers

The most long-lasting rollers in the market are nylon garage door rollers. Nylon is a flexible material. Despite the lightweight nature of nylon polymer, nylon rollers are very durable.
Pro
Nylon rollers are the most silent rollers for door movement along the tracks.
Con
The nylon rollers are the most expensive door rollers in the market.
Steel Rollers

Steel rollers are more durable than plastic rollers. Moreover, because of the sturdy material of the wheels and stem, steel rollers can carry heavy weights of door material more efficiently.
Pro
Steel rollers have ball bearings that help in supporting the movement of the doors in the garage.
Con
Steel components corrode in time and get more effects from exposure to external elements. It’s common to find rust in unmaintained parts of the rollers.
Plastic Rollers

Plastic rollers are the most common type of rollers for all garages. Many brands and sets of doors come with the standard plastic roller.
Pro
Plastic rollers are the most affordable type of rollers. For a reasonable amount, the rollers can last up to three years of constant use.
Con
If you’re looking for more durable alternatives, plastic rollers are the last thing you should install in your garage. You can upgrade to steel or nylon rollers for longevity.
